Exciting Opportunity for a Geriatrics (COE) Consultant in Durham
Are you a dedicated and experienced Geriatrics (COE) Consultant seeking an immediate opportunity to make a positive impact on geriatric patient care?
Pulse is thrilled to offer an immediate opening for a Consultant in Care of the Elderly to cover full-time shifts, Monday to Friday, with a dynamic and rewarding full rota schedule in Durham. This position presents a unique opportunity to contribute to the well-being of elderly patients within a supportive and collaborative multidisciplinary team.
As a Geriatrics Consultant, you will play a pivotal role in providing comprehensive care to geriatric patients, including assessment, diagnosis, treatment, and ongoing management of age-related conditions. With a full rota schedule, you’ll have the opportunity to make a meaningful difference in the lives of elderly patients while enjoying a balanced work-life schedule.
This is a three-month position with the potential for extension, offering the chance to make a lasting impact on patient care while furthering your professional development. If you’re passionate about caring for the elderly and are ready to take on a rewarding challenge, we want to hear from you.
At Pulse, we recognise the importance of dedicated healthcare professionals who are committed to making a difference. If you are ready to embrace a challenging yet rewarding role, we invite you to join us in our mission to provide exceptional care to patients in Durham.
We are seeking experienced individuals who possess a strong clinical background in Care of the Elderly and a genuine passion for patient care.
Requirements:
- GMC Registration
- Right to work in the UK
- Relevant experience as a Consultant in Care of the Elderly
